ive got my first ever rexes- what would you reccommend for indoor use ? im using fleece blankets at the moment.
 
ive got my first ever rexes- what would you reccommend for indoor use ? im using fleece blankets at the moment.


Tile/Wood/Vinyl flooring in the house is less abrassive than carpet. Binkying about on carpet often strips the already fine fure from Rexes hocks and thats when problems start.
I have my Rexes on a shredded paper and soft hay substrate as I have even found Vetbed to be too abrassive for some of them.
